What is Advance Materials EV-to-FCF?

Advance Materials ROCO:3585 -6.33% 44 EV-to-FCF is -109.56 as of Jul. 14, 2026. GuruFocus rates ROCO:3585 with a GF Score™ of 44/100 and a GF Value™ of NT$8.93 (Significantly Overvalued). The stock has 3 warning signs investors should review. Among 1,334 Hardware companies, Advance Materials ranks worse than 74962.44% on this metric.

EV-to-FCF is calculated as enterprise value divided by its free cash flow. As of today, Advance Materials's Enterprise Value is NT$6,190.4 Mil. Advance Materials's Free Cash Flow for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was NT$-56.5 Mil. Therefore, Advance Materials's EV-to-FCF for today is -109.56.

Enterprise Value is used because it is a more complete measure in reflecting how much an investor pays when buying a company. Free Cash Flow is an important financial metric because it represents the actual amount of cash at a company's disposal. Companies with a low EV-to-FCF ratio, combined with a strong balance sheet are generally considered as undervalued.

Advance Materials EV-to-FCF Calculation

Advance Materials's EV-to-FCF for today is calculated as:

EV-to-FCF=Enterprise Value (Today)/Free Cash Flow (TTM)
=6190.364/-56.503
=-109.56

Advance Materials's current Enterprise Value is NT$6,190.4 Mil.
For company reported semi-annually, GuruFocus uses latest annual data as the TTM data. Advance Materials's Free Cash Flow for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was NT$-56.5 Mil.

Advance Materials Business Description

Address No.2 of 498 Lane, Luzhu Village, Taoyuan County, TWN
Advance Materials Corp is a professional supplier of electronic materials in Taiwan. Its products include Copper Clad Laminate, Liquid photo-imageable solder masks, Special Photoresist, FPC Materials related products, and Touch Panel Related Materials.
